Checklist of Promotion Opportunities
- Submit a press release or news announcement on your Summit Day to news@eclipse.org for the http://www.eclipse.org homepage and RSS feeds
- Submit a press release or news announcement on your Summit Day to http://www.eclipseplugincentral.com/Submit_News+index.html for the http://www.eclipseplugincentral.com (EPIC) homepage
- Email details of your event to events@eclipse.org to be posted on the Community Events calendar at http://www.eclipse.org/community/events/
- Post details of your event to an Eclipse newsgroup at http://www.eclipse.org/newsgroups/ - eclipse.foundation is probably best
- Post details of your event to Eclipsepedia at http://wiki.eclipse.org/Conferences
- Blog about your event - it's especially helpful if the writer's blog is aggregated on www.planeteclipse.org
- Record a podcast or video interview on your event and submit it to http://live.eclipse.org
- Make sure your membership page at http://www.eclipse.org/membership/exploreMembership.php is up to date by using http://portal.eclipse.org; once updated, go to your page and from the Interact menu on the right side, suggest the name of your event as a new tag
